diff options
| author | liuxueli <[email protected]> | 2021-09-10 13:19:28 +0800 |
|---|---|---|
| committer | liuxueli <[email protected]> | 2021-09-10 13:19:28 +0800 |
| commit | fc462eb0b59ae4d3e96fe87c3559a86ac7e76b78 (patch) | |
| tree | 2ca42343e123d59fb4cd8cceaa8e397004ef30a2 /src/quic_analysis.cpp | |
| parent | c67f8195f55fc8872e4708963a94500d571b05d0 (diff) | |
TSG-7725: 解析TAG_NUM出现异常导致SAPP重启
Diffstat (limited to 'src/quic_analysis.cpp')
| -rw-r--r-- | src/quic_analysis.cpp | 13 |
1 files changed, 7 insertions, 6 deletions
diff --git a/src/quic_analysis.cpp b/src/quic_analysis.cpp index 23dff35..3aee5f1 100644 --- a/src/quic_analysis.cpp +++ b/src/quic_analysis.cpp @@ -108,8 +108,7 @@ void quic_release_stream(void** pme, int thread_seq) extern "C" int QUIC_INIT(void) { - int ret=0,level=30; - char log_path[1024]={0}; + int ret=0; FILE *fp=NULL; char buf[2048]={0}; int region_id=0; @@ -117,13 +116,15 @@ extern "C" int QUIC_INIT(void) memset(&g_quic_param,0,sizeof(struct _quic_param_t)); - MESA_load_profile_int_def(g_quic_proto_conffile, "QUIC", "LOG_LEVEL", &level, RLOG_LV_FATAL); - MESA_load_profile_string_def(g_quic_proto_conffile, "QUIC", "LOG_PATH", log_path, sizeof(log_path), "./log/quic/quic"); + MESA_load_profile_int_def(g_quic_proto_conffile, "QUIC", "LOG_LEVEL", &g_quic_param.level, RLOG_LV_FATAL); + MESA_load_profile_string_def(g_quic_proto_conffile, "QUIC", "LOG_PATH", g_quic_param.log_path, sizeof(g_quic_param.log_path), "./log/quic/quic"); - g_quic_param.logger=MESA_create_runtime_log_handle(log_path, level); + MESA_load_profile_int_def(g_quic_proto_conffile, "QUIC", "DUMP_PCAKET_SWITCH", &g_quic_param.dump_packet_switch, 0); + + g_quic_param.logger=MESA_create_runtime_log_handle(g_quic_param.log_path, g_quic_param.level); if(g_quic_param.logger==NULL) { - printf("MESA_create_runtime_log_handle failed, level: %d log_path: %s", level, log_path); + printf("MESA_create_runtime_log_handle failed, level: %d log_path: %s", g_quic_param.level, g_quic_param.log_path); return -1; } |
